Pub, shops and houses in Salmon Lane
Description
Pub, shops and houses at 51-65 Salmon Lane, Limehouse, viewed from Salmon Lane near Camdenhurst Street looking north-west. From left to right, in the background are some houses then a greengrocery shop on the corner of Salmon Lane and Conder Street with goods displayed outside. There is a man outside the grocery. On the next corner at 53 is the Royal Navy pub which was established in the nineteenth century. It was supplied by Mann’s brewery in Whitechapel; Manns is written on the pub sign. It closed in 1999 and in 2003 was converted into flats, the green-tiled frontage and the style of the windows and door being preserved though it has lost its pub sign and there are now railings round the front to protect it. The windows of the shop at 55 are whitewashed, which indicates closure. The houses from 57 to 65 in the foreground all have arched doorways and windows on the ground floor and there is some fancy brickwork at the top of each of them. All the windows are sash windows. There are railings in front of the houses as they all have an ‘area’ leading down to a lower ground floor. There are also several stabilising metal bolts in a line across all of the houses and two of the houses have lucky horseshoes nailed above their front doors. A man is entering the gate of number 57. Number 65 is on the corner with Camdenhurst Street and at its side there is an advert for the Victoria Tin Box Co Ltd which makes “boxes of all types”. There is also some graffiti saying West Ham. Part of a van parked across the road from the houses can be seen. The grocer’s is now a modern house, as is the shop with whitewashed windows and the houses are now a block of flats. There are railings in front of the modern houses but these are not the original ones. The ‘areas’ have been paved over so that there is now no entry to the lower ground floors from the street.
